Transaction 19f528981a3a156d80e68591caa1b0a8f0c378940c4eaa43c4f59352ca378197

1 Input
2 Outputs
  • 19f528981a3a156d80e68591caa1b0a8f0c378940c4eaa43c4f59352ca378197:0
  • value  17947259744
    address  2NB4WeergnSobKe6BJKvXqNVocbXRyVZgQH
  • 19f528981a3a156d80e68591caa1b0a8f0c378940c4eaa43c4f59352ca378197:1
  • value  1553092
    address  2NCyW2dJaqD6bc48DPWtQPyvxJmmTb8HcCa